Bajrang Punia cut short his trip in Turkey, returns back to India, take a look why ?

By   - 07/01/2020

It can’t get more bizarre than this. India’s biggest medal winning hope for Tokyo 2020 Bajrang Punia has cut short his training trip in Turkey and has returned back to India. Punia left for Turkey on 3-week training trip on 29th Dec and was also supposed to compete at Yasar Dogu international beginning on Friday this week. But he decided to cut short his trip and has returned to India on 4th Dec only after 4 days in Turkey.

The reason for this development is nothing less than bizarre.

WrestlingTV has learnt from its sources that Bajrang’s coach Shako Bentinidis could not procure his visa to travel to Turkey which led to Punia returning back to India. Bajrang had left for Turkey without his coach expecting that after getting his visas processed Shako will join him in Turkey. But the delays in Visa processing led to frustrated Bajrang returning back to India as it was getting difficult for him to manage things on his own in Turkey.

India’s star grappler Bajrang Punia had decided to make Turkey his base for 3 weeks in order to prepare for the 2020 season. The Wrestling Federation of India (WFI) had approved Punia’s proposal to train in Turkey along with his coach Shako Bentinidis. The Asian Games 2018 gold medallist Indian was also supposed to compete at Yasar Dogu international event in Turkey along with fellow wrestler Jitender. From Turkey itself, Punia was scheduled to fly to Rome for the ranking series event starting on 15th January.

Bajrang will now train in Sonepat itself in the national camp by WFI and will fly with the Indian squad to Rome for the ranking series event.
